=== PHASE 1: CODE REVIEW PASS (changed surface only) ===
- Read every changed source file in full (context matters), but raise findings ONLY on changed or directly-affected lines.
- Correctness sweep:
- Logic errors, inverted conditions, off-by-one boundaries.
- Unhandled null/empty/error paths on changed lines.
- Broken error propagation: swallowed exceptions, catch-and-continue, missing awaits.
- Concurrency and ordering hazards introduced by the change.
- Contract breaks for existing callers of modified functions — grep the callers and check each one.
- Simplification sweep (after correctness, never instead of it):
- Duplication introduced by this diff of code that already exists in the project.
- Dead code added (unreachable branches, unused exports).
- Needless abstraction or complexity that a stdlib or existing project utility already covers.
- Record each finding: PASS-tag R#, severity (BLOCKER = wrong behavior or broken caller; NIT = works but should improve), file:line, one-line evidence, concrete fix.
VALIDATION: every changed source file has been read; findings list (possibly empty) recorded with the per-file coverage list.
FALLBACK: diff too large to read fully (>~5000 changed lines): gate the riskiest files first (source > config > UI > docs), report exact coverage ("reviewed 34/61 files"), and cap the verdict at MERGE-WITH-NITS — an unread diff can never earn a clean MERGE.
=== PHASE 2: SECURITY PASS (changed surface only) ===
- Injection: any changed line where external input reaches SQL/NoSQL/shell/eval/HTML/template without parameterization or encoding.
- Authz: new or modified endpoints, routes, handlers, or DB rules — verify an auth check exists and matches siblings; flag IDOR patterns (object fetched by user-supplied ID without ownership check).
- Secrets: scan the DIFF TEXT (
git diff $MB..HEAD) for keys, tokens, passwords, private keys, connection strings — including in deleted lines (a removed secret is still leaked in history: flag for rotation).
- Dependency diff: if manifests/lockfiles changed, list added/upgraded packages; check each addition for typosquat-ish names and run the ecosystem's audit (
npm audit, pip-audit, cargo audit) if the tool is present. New Critical/High vulns introduced by the diff = BLOCKER.
- Findings tagged S#, severity (BLOCKER = exploitable or leaked secret; NIT = hardening), file:line, fix.
VALIDATION: all four checks executed or explicitly n/a (e.g. "no dependency changes").
FALLBACK: audit tool absent: report "dependency vulns unchecked — not installed" as a coverage gap; do not fabricate a clean result.
=== PHASE 3: TEST PASS ===
- Run the full suite with the detected command. Record pass/fail counts and any failures with output excerpts. Any failing test that passes on the base branch = BLOCKER T#.
- Untested-changed-lines check: for each changed source file, find its tests (path convention, same-name test file, grep for the symbol names in test dirs). Changed public functions/branches with no test exercising them get a T# finding: BLOCKER if the change is behavioral logic in non-trivial code paths, NIT for trivial/presentational changes.
- If a coverage tool is configured, run it scoped to changed files for line-level evidence; otherwise use the symbol-grep method and say so.
VALIDATION: suite executed (or "no test suite" recorded as a standing finding), untested-changes list produced.
FALLBACK: suite is too slow (>10 min estimate) : run the test files related to changed code plus any smoke/fast target, and report the narrowed scope; a narrowed test pass caps the verdict at MERGE-WITH-NITS.
=== PHASE 4: A11Y PASS (only if UI files changed) ===
- Skip cleanly with "no UI files changed" if the Phase 0 inventory has no UI files.
- Static checks on changed UI code:
- Images/icons without alt text or a semantic label.
- Interactive elements that are not native buttons/links and lack role + tabindex + keyboard handling.
- Form inputs without associated labels (for/id, aria-label, or wrapping label).
- Color values introduced without a contrast-checkable pairing — flag for manual contrast check.
- Focus traps and removed focus outlines (outline: none without a replacement).
- Touch targets below ~44-48px where sizes are explicit in the diff.
- Missing Semantics wrappers on interactive Flutter widgets.
- Findings tagged A#: BLOCKER = unusable by keyboard/screen reader (e.g. click-div with no role/tabindex on a primary action); NIT = degraded experience.
VALIDATION: every changed UI file checked or pass skipped with reason.
FALLBACK: framework's a11y idioms unknown: apply the WAI-ARIA-level checks (labels, roles, keyboard) which are framework-independent, and note the limitation.
=== PHASE 5: VERDICT ===
Aggregate: any BLOCKER anywhere -> BLOCK. No blockers but any NIT or any coverage gap/cap from fallbacks -> MERGE-WITH-NITS. Otherwise -> MERGE. Never soften a BLOCKER into a nit because the fix is easy; easy fixes make BLOCK cheap to resolve.
